When I'M In Your Arms



Outside the world is dark
Rain is pouring down
Sunlight is blocked by rain clouds
I'm inside with all the lights one
Trying to make everything seem brighter

Everything is in the light
But still it feels so dark and cold
I want to hold you in my arms
So I'll know your real and here
Need to feel your warmth near me

Everything is so much better with you
You chase away the darkness
Make everything brighter
Nothing can be wrong
When I'm in your arms

Lightning is streaking the sky
Every thunder clap makes me jump
You pull me closer to you
Surrounding me with your warmth
But still the thunder scares me

One loud clap of thunder
All the lights go out
I can't see anything
But I can still feel you holding me tight
You make me feel so safe
